Which has more demand in present day – Computer Science OR Information Technology?
First, computer science and IT jobs are not necessarily mutually exclusive. Yes, you will find very few people with a purely IT background working as software engineers, but there is a great deal of overlap between the two fields. Many people with MIS/IT backgrounds get jobs as programmers and software developers with technology firms, and many people with computer science degrees end up working as IT auditors/analysts in a more business-oriented setting. That being said and the nuances clarified, I would say (from my personal experiences) that there is definitely more demand for IT/MIS folks, but computer science people typically command higher salaries, especially in entry to mid-level positions.
